ERLINE HARMSE


Educational Assistant Diploma - 2004

What brought you to Portage College and your program of study?

As a new immigrant in 2002 I wanted to go into a program that helped people. I started the Rehabilitation Practitioner program at first and then since it had many similarities with the Educational Assistant Program, I transitioned over after a year. I loved the location of the campus, the small class sizes....the student life. It was very exciting!

What was your favorite memory while attending Portage College?

We had ALOT of fun while I was a student, but my curling career was a highlight. Though we didn't necessarily always win- we had fun. We got to compete against some great curlers from other colleges and it was a great experience.

What was the colleges greatest impact on your personal and professional life?

Finishing at the College with great marks and amazing support, it was absolutely perfection to be hired at the College in the formerly known Learning Assistance Centre (Now SLS). I got to experience helping other students succeed and meet their goals. The College taught me that we are all here to help each other.

What are you up to now?

I am STLL at the College, now working in the Alumni Department under Community Relations. Almost 22 years with the Voyageurs!
